GLENDALE MANAGEMENT ASSOCIATION is a small nonprofit that reported $168K in total revenue in fiscal year 2025. Revenue surged 46% from the prior year, signaling strong growth momentum. The organization ran a surplus of $101K, a strong 60% operating margin.

Mission

THE PURPOSE OF THE ORGANIZATION IS TO IMPROVE THE TERMS AND CONDITIONS OF EMPLOYMENT FOR THE MEMBERS OF THE ASSOCIATION. THE ASSOCIATION WILL ACT INDEPENDENTLY TO SUPPORT ISSUES, PROGRAMS, AND PROJECTS OF INTEREST TO MANAGEMENT, AND TO NEGOTIATE A COLLECTIVE BARGAINING AGREEMENT WITH THE CITY OF GLENDALE ON BEHALF OF MANAGERS ELIGIBLE FOR MEMBERSHIP IN THIS ASSOCIATION.IN FURTHERANCE OF THE ORGANIZATION'S GOAL TO IMPROVE THE TERMS AND CONDITIONS OF EMPLOYMENT WITHIN THE CITY OF GLENDALE, THIS ORGANIZATION WILL PROVIDE SUPPORT FOR CHARITABLE AND SOCIAL BENEFIT ACTIVITIES. ANY ORGANIZATIONS RECEIVING ASSISTANCE FROM THE ASSOCIATION SHALL PROVIDE DIRECT BENEFIT TO RESIDENTS AND/OR BUSINESSES IN THE CITY OF GLENDALE.
